{"id":"https://openalex.org/W7160237792","doi":"https://doi.org/10.48550/arxiv.2605.02220","title":"Cerberus: Cross-Layer ECC Co-Design for Robust and Efficient Memory Protection","display_name":"Cerberus: Cross-Layer ECC Co-Design for Robust and Efficient Memory Protection","publication_year":2026,"publication_date":"2026-05-04","ids":{"openalex":"https://openalex.org/W7160237792","doi":"https://doi.org/10.48550/arxiv.2605.02220"},"language":null,"primary_location":{"id":"doi:10.48550/arxiv.2605.02220","is_oa":true,"landing_page_url":"https://doi.org/10.48550/arxiv.2605.02220","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"Preprint"},"type":"preprint","indexed_in":["datacite"],"open_access":{"is_oa":true,"oa_status":"green","oa_url":"https://doi.org/10.48550/arxiv.2605.02220","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5135328487","display_name":"Junhwan Kim","orcid":null},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Kim, Junhwan","raw_affiliation_strings":[],"raw_orcid":null,"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5135345286","display_name":"Seunghyun Kim","orcid":null},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Kim, Seunghyun","raw_affiliation_strings":[],"raw_orcid":null,"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5047352904","display_name":"Yesin Ryu","orcid":"https://orcid.org/0000-0002-2678-7396"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Ryu, Yesin","raw_affiliation_strings":[],"raw_orcid":null,"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5135379890","display_name":"Saeid Gorgin","orcid":null},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Gorgin, Saeid","raw_affiliation_strings":[],"raw_orcid":null,"affiliations":[]},{"author_position":"last","author":{"id":"https://openalex.org/A5084281731","display_name":"Jungrae Kim","orcid":"https://orcid.org/0000-0003-1587-0677"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Kim, Jungrae","raw_affiliation_strings":[],"raw_orcid":null,"affiliations":[]}],"institutions":[],"countries_distinct_count":0,"institutions_distinct_count":0,"corresponding_author_ids":[],"corresponding_institution_ids":[],"apc_list":null,"apc_paid":null,"fwci":null,"has_fulltext":false,"cited_by_count":0,"citation_normalized_percentile":null,"cited_by_percentile_year":null,"biblio":{"volume":null,"issue":null,"first_page":null,"last_page":null},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T11005","display_name":"Radiation Effects in Electronics","score":0.651199996471405,"subfield":{"id":"https://openalex.org/subfields/2208","display_name":"Electrical and Electronic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T11005","display_name":"Radiation Effects in Electronics","score":0.651199996471405,"subfield":{"id":"https://openalex.org/subfields/2208","display_name":"Electrical and Electronic Engineering"},"field":{"id":"https://openalex.org/fields/22","display_name":"Engineering"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11181","display_name":"Advanced Data Storage Technologies","score":0.20340000092983246,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11032","display_name":"VLSI and Analog Circuit Testing","score":0.03500000014901161,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/redundancy","display_name":"Redundancy (engineering)","score":0.7939000129699707},{"id":"https://openalex.org/keywords/dram","display_name":"Dram","score":0.7853999733924866},{"id":"https://openalex.org/keywords/correctness","display_name":"Correctness","score":0.5881999731063843},{"id":"https://openalex.org/keywords/resilience","display_name":"Resilience (materials science)","score":0.3725000023841858},{"id":"https://openalex.org/keywords/encoding","display_name":"Encoding (memory)","score":0.36149999499320984},{"id":"https://openalex.org/keywords/random-access-memory","display_name":"Random access memory","score":0.34709998965263367},{"id":"https://openalex.org/keywords/fault-tolerance","display_name":"Fault tolerance","score":0.34389999508857727},{"id":"https://openalex.org/keywords/data-integrity","display_name":"Data integrity","score":0.3294000029563904}],"concepts":[{"id":"https://openalex.org/C152124472","wikidata":"https://www.wikidata.org/wiki/Q1204361","display_name":"Redundancy (engineering)","level":2,"score":0.7939000129699707},{"id":"https://openalex.org/C7366592","wikidata":"https://www.wikidata.org/wiki/Q1255620","display_name":"Dram","level":2,"score":0.7853999733924866},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.6643000245094299},{"id":"https://openalex.org/C55439883","wikidata":"https://www.wikidata.org/wiki/Q360812","display_name":"Correctness","level":2,"score":0.5881999731063843},{"id":"https://openalex.org/C149635348","wikidata":"https://www.wikidata.org/wiki/Q193040","display_name":"Embedded system","level":1,"score":0.3885999917984009},{"id":"https://openalex.org/C200601418","wikidata":"https://www.wikidata.org/wiki/Q2193887","display_name":"Reliability engineering","level":1,"score":0.3792000114917755},{"id":"https://openalex.org/C2779585090","wikidata":"https://www.wikidata.org/wiki/Q3457762","display_name":"Resilience (materials science)","level":2,"score":0.3725000023841858},{"id":"https://openalex.org/C125411270","wikidata":"https://www.wikidata.org/wiki/Q18653","display_name":"Encoding (memory)","level":2,"score":0.36149999499320984},{"id":"https://openalex.org/C2994168587","wikidata":"https://www.wikidata.org/wiki/Q5295","display_name":"Random access memory","level":2,"score":0.34709998965263367},{"id":"https://openalex.org/C63540848","wikidata":"https://www.wikidata.org/wiki/Q3140932","display_name":"Fault tolerance","level":2,"score":0.34389999508857727},{"id":"https://openalex.org/C33762810","wikidata":"https://www.wikidata.org/wiki/Q461671","display_name":"Data integrity","level":2,"score":0.3294000029563904},{"id":"https://openalex.org/C100800780","wikidata":"https://www.wikidata.org/wiki/Q1175867","display_name":"Memory controller","level":3,"score":0.32409998774528503},{"id":"https://openalex.org/C120314980","wikidata":"https://www.wikidata.org/wiki/Q180634","display_name":"Distributed computing","level":1,"score":0.3052999973297119},{"id":"https://openalex.org/C193519340","wikidata":"https://www.wikidata.org/wiki/Q891179","display_name":"Data loss","level":2,"score":0.30399999022483826},{"id":"https://openalex.org/C206729178","wikidata":"https://www.wikidata.org/wiki/Q2271896","display_name":"Scheduling (production processes)","level":2,"score":0.29019999504089355},{"id":"https://openalex.org/C131521367","wikidata":"https://www.wikidata.org/wiki/Q625502","display_name":"Parity bit","level":2,"score":0.28859999775886536},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.2806999981403351},{"id":"https://openalex.org/C78766204","wikidata":"https://www.wikidata.org/wiki/Q555032","display_name":"Multi-core processor","level":2,"score":0.27709999680519104},{"id":"https://openalex.org/C179518139","wikidata":"https://www.wikidata.org/wiki/Q5140297","display_name":"Coding (social sciences)","level":2,"score":0.27239999175071716},{"id":"https://openalex.org/C7545210","wikidata":"https://www.wikidata.org/wiki/Q838123","display_name":"Data redundancy","level":2,"score":0.26179999113082886},{"id":"https://openalex.org/C118702147","wikidata":"https://www.wikidata.org/wiki/Q189396","display_name":"Dynamic random-access memory","level":3,"score":0.26109999418258667},{"id":"https://openalex.org/C31258907","wikidata":"https://www.wikidata.org/wiki/Q1301371","display_name":"Computer network","level":1,"score":0.25619998574256897}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.48550/arxiv.2605.02220","is_oa":true,"landing_page_url":"https://doi.org/10.48550/arxiv.2605.02220","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":null,"raw_source_name":null,"raw_type":"Preprint"}],"best_oa_location":{"id":"doi:10.48550/arxiv.2605.02220","is_oa":true,"landing_page_url":"https://doi.org/10.48550/arxiv.2605.02220","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"Preprint"},"sustainable_development_goals":[{"id":"https://metadata.un.org/sdg/9","score":0.5298017859458923,"display_name":"Industry, innovation and infrastructure"}],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":0,"referenced_works":[],"related_works":[],"abstract_inverted_index":{"As":[0],"DRAM":[1],"scales":[2],"to":[3,126,143],"higher":[4],"density":[5],"and":[6,28,44,60,95,104,116,121,130,145],"I/O":[7],"speeds,":[8],"ensuring":[9],"data":[10],"correctness":[11],"becomes":[12],"increasingly":[13],"difficult.":[14],"Industry":[15],"has":[16],"responded":[17],"with":[18],"a":[19,50,82],"three-layer":[20],"stack:":[21],"on-die":[22],"ECC":[23,26,30,52],"(O-ECC),":[24],"link":[25],"(L-ECC),":[27],"system":[29,61],"(S-ECC).":[31],"However,":[32],"these":[33],"layers":[34],"have":[35],"evolved":[36],"independently,":[37],"often":[38],"duplicating":[39],"redundancy,":[40],"leaving":[41],"coverage":[42],"gaps,":[43],"occasionally":[45],"interfering.":[46],"We":[47],"propose":[48],"Cerberus,":[49],"cross-layer":[51,157],"co-design":[53],"that":[54],"unifies":[55],"protection":[56,158],"across":[57],"device,":[58],"link,":[59],"while":[62,148],"preserving":[63],"the":[64,79,123,153],"native":[65],"role":[66],"of":[67,155],"each":[68],"layer.":[69],"At":[70],"its":[71],"core":[72],"is":[73,87],"an":[74],"Encode-Once,":[75],"Decode-Many":[76],"(EODM)":[77],"architecture:":[78],"controller":[80],"performs":[81],"single":[83],"encoding":[84],"whose":[85],"redundancy":[86,136],"reused":[88],"by":[89,97,105],"L-ECC":[90],"for":[91,99,107,159],"immediate":[92],"write-path":[93],"detection":[94],"retry,":[96],"O-ECC":[98],"in-device":[100],"repair":[101],"on":[102],"reads,":[103],"S-ECC":[106],"strong":[108],"end-to-end":[109],"recovery.":[110],"Cerberus":[111],"jointly":[112],"designs":[113],"complementary":[114],"parity":[115],"syndrome":[117],"structures,":[118],"orders":[119],"decoders,":[120],"allocates":[122],"correction":[124,133],"budget":[125],"prevent":[127],"miscorrection":[128],"amplification":[129],"enable":[131],"selective":[132],"under":[134],"tight":[135],"constraints.":[137],"Our":[138],"evaluations":[139],"show":[140],"improved":[141],"resilience":[142],"clustered":[144],"peripheral":[146],"faults":[147],"reducing":[149],"redundant":[150],"overhead,":[151],"underscoring":[152],"importance":[154],"coordinated":[156],"next-generation":[160],"memory":[161],"systems,":[162],"such":[163],"as":[164],"custom":[165],"HBMs.":[166]},"counts_by_year":[],"updated_date":"2026-07-01T06:00:48.157686","created_date":"2026-05-06T00:00:00"}
